# Who to Contact: LargeLens Diff Viewer

LargeLens renders diffs for files up to 2 GB and is maintained by the Tooling Guild at Hollowbrook Systems. For support tickets: rendering glitches, truncated hunks, or memory errors should include the file size and the viewer version from the About panel. Feature requests go through the quarterly intake, not tickets. Urgent outages affecting multiple customers should skip the queue entirely — in that case, write directly to the maintainers.

escalation mailbox, bafog-fafog: ulador@paliqlabs.internal

## Deployment

Terracount's offline mode lets surveyors collect records in areas with no coverage; data queues locally and syncs when connectivity returns. Deploy the sync gateway before distributing devices — clients refuse to enter offline mode without a registered gateway handshake. Conflicts resolve last-write-wins per field, not per record. As a contractor, you only deploy the gateway; device provisioning is handled internally. The gateway starts with the configuration below.

service settings:
PRAIX_LOG_LEVEL=error
PRAIX_METRICS_HOST=metrics.praix.qorvelcorp.corp
PRAIX_POOL_SIZE=16

**Q: What happens when a user-supplied formula looks sketchy?**

All formulas in Gridlet run inside the Fencepost sandbox — no network, no filesystem, 200ms CPU cap. If a formula trips the cap, the cell shows a timeout error and we log it, nothing more. You only need to act if the sandbox escape alarm fires. The full escalation steps live on the internal runbook page below.

operations page: https://jenkins.zemvarcloud.local/job/merge_requests/repo/build/73930b4b30f0a8ed